How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Holbrook?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Holbrook Studio Apartments | $1,751 | $963 | $3,750 |
Holbrook 1 Bedroom Apartments | $939 | $650 | $2,580 |
Holbrook 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,111 | $610 | $3,170 |
Holbrook 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,154 | $480 | $1,985 |
Holbrook 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,085 | $475 | $2,600 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Holbrook
How much are Studio apartments in Holbrook?
There are currently 3 Studio Apartments in Holbrook with rent ranges from $963 to $3,750 with an average price of $1,751.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Holbrook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Holbrook ranges from $650 to $2,580 with an average monthly rent of $939.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Holbrook c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Holbrook range from $610 to $3,170.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,111.
How expensive are Holbrook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 23 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Holbrook on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$480 to $1,985 - averaging $1,154 for the location.
